What is called management?

Management is the coordination and administration of tasks to achieve a goal. Such administration activities include setting the organization's strategy and coordinating the efforts of staff to accomplish these objectives through the application of available resources.

What is the types of manager?

There are three main types of managers: general managers, functional managers, and frontline managers. General managers are responsible for the overall performance of an organization or one of its major self-contained subunits or divisions. Functional managers lead a particular function or a subunit within a function.

What are the roles of management?

The four primary functions of managers are planning, organizing, leading, and controlling. By using the four functions, managers work to increase the efficiency and effectiveness of their employees, processes, projects, and organizations as a whole.

Is managing a skill?

Management skills are a collection of abilities that include things such as business planning, decision-making, problem-solving, communication, delegation, and time management. ... In top management, these skills are essential to run an organization well and achieve desired business objectives.
